    Hi everyone,

    So my case has been “ready for interview” since 10/25/19 and I know it’s pretty normal to wait a while after that. However, i have read a few stories on here about how people got rejected because they didn’t show up to their interview (but actually never got the interview date notice in the mail) and I’m really really nervous about that. My husband and I can’t really afford to reapply in terms of both finances and time and I would hate to be rejected because of a mailing issue. I obsessively check mycase to see my status online but I was wondering if that is reliable? Will my status online change the minute my interview date is scheduled? Is there any other way to check if your interview was scheduled without relying on mail?         If it still says "ready for review", then I believe they haven't issued the interview date yet. If it says "interview has been scheduled" then they've scheduled the interview. Normally, it may take up to 6 months to get the date. However, it generally is issued within 3 months.
